溫馨提示×

kafka集群部署能應對大數據量嗎

小樊
100
2024-12-17 03:50:30
欄目: 大數據

是的,Kafka集群部署能夠應對大數據量。通過合理規劃和配置,Kafka集群可以處理和分析大規模數據集。以下是具體的配置和優化建議:

集群配置建議

  • 節點數量和角色:根據數據量和預期的并發量,決定需要多少臺服務器來部署Kafka集群,包括ZooKeeper服務器和Kafka Broker。
  • 副本因子:設置合理的副本因子以確保數據的高可用性和容錯性。
  • 分區策略:合理規劃分區數量,確保數據均勻分布,提高并行處理能力。
  • 存儲配置:根據數據量和訪問頻率,選擇合適的存儲設備(如SSD或HDD)和配置。

性能優化建議

  • 網絡優化:確保集群內部的網絡帶寬和延遲達到最優,以支持高效的數據傳輸。
  • 硬件資源優化:根據數據量和處理需求,增加CPU、內存等硬件資源。
  • 壓縮和批處理:啟用消息壓縮以減少存儲和網絡開銷,同時使用批量發送和獲取消息來提高吞吐量。

監控和管理

  • 實施有效的監控和管理策略,以確保集群的穩定運行和性能優化。

通過上述配置和優化措施,Kafka集群可以有效地應對大數據量的處理需求,提供高吞吐量、低延遲的消息處理服務。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女